    Did you just pick up the 24-105? are you asking about the 17-55 to compliment or are you wondering if you made the right choice? I own the 60D/24-105 combo and love it, but folks will be quick to point out that 24mm on the 60D is not all that wide. For me it was the right choice because my favorite subjects (landscapes/kids sports) are outdoors and the combo provides a bit of protection from the elements. I learned the hard way with a lens that wasn't weather sealed. Ask yourself what you need. If that's hard to answer then experiment with what you have for a bit. There are often multiple solutions to one need. Need something faster than f4, you can pick up an inexpensive prime to go with your 24-105. Depending on your choice it may be much faster than f2.8. Something wider on occasion? You can add a 10-20 something and go really wide. Want one lens that that will be a bit wider and a bit faster, go with the 17-55. Need more length than 55, pick up a tele prime or zoom to go with it.
